BA refund...help please!!!

Hi to everyone here,

As a newbie to this site (and not a member of the BA exec club) apologies if I'm in the wrong forum. Can anyone help me with this dilemma?

I have a fully flexible one-way ticket (booked on ba.com) from NCL-LHR which I couldn't use. I initially changed my original flight BA1329 at 1645 for a later one BA1337 at 1940 on the same date but then called BA reservations well before my flight to advise that I couldn't travel and to request a refund. The lady I spoke to explained that there was a £15.00 cancellation fee if the refund was made over the phone but no charge if done online. Okay I thought, I'll do that online. But when I went to "manage my booking" I couldn't access my booking. I went online well after my flight at about 11pm. I tried several times but each time it was unable to bring up the booking and suggested I contacted BA. When I called back later I was told I was a no-show and couldn't cancel my flight online. I explained how I was informed otherwise by the BA lady earlier. I was then told that the ability to cancel online was an extra tool and that I had to pay the cancellation fee. I thought that was outrageous. I didn't even know BA charges fees on domestic C fares. Also, how can I be a no-show if I called BA reservations to let them know I couldn't travel? Please can anyone advise me what to do? I was told I would definitely be charged the £15.00 fee. Should I write to Customer Relations? Thanks.
